what is the explanatory gap?

A

mental states cannot be explained in neuro-biological claims because

  • not analyzable in functional terms
  • experiences cannot be fully explained

what remains to be explained: consciousness

The claim that even if we have all physical information about our brains/bodies, we cannot
explain at least some mental states (consciousness).

What do defenders of the explanatory gap think is unexplainable, and why?

A

experience. what it is like. would mary learn something new?

Phenomenal consciousness, or the specific quality of / what its-like to be in some physical state. Most
arguments appeal to the fact that causal, structural, and functional states are always logically compatible
with—that is, do not entail—conscious states. In other words, we can’t capture phenomenal states in
strictly functional or structural terms.
